Comments: I am interested in locating anyone who may have information about a sea-going tug, LT-636, skippered by Charles J. Roy, my uncle, a civilian, which was towing a crane barge to South Korea from Wonsan, when it hit a mine and sank. Roy and a several other individuals made it to the crane-barge and were rescued several days later. One of the survivors was an army sergeant.I have no other information other than my uncle was alleged to be the first U.S. civilian casualty during the Korean war. I would appreciate any and all information about this incident. Roy is now deceased and he has one surviving son, age 80, who does not have all the information about his dad and his activities in Korea.

Comments: i am trying to get some information for my dad, bill (howard) brighton. he served in the navy, pacific theatre. he was a quartermaster on the apc 42. i am having trouble finding anything about the apc transport ships. i know they were small coastal transports. they were made of wood and nicknamed "jack of all trades." those who served aboard the wooden ships were "ironmen." there were only 89 of these built. any information about them or pictures of them would be greatly appreciated. it would be especially nice to help him get in contact with some of his shipmates.
